Transforming Urban Spaces: A Rooftop Revelation
In the heart of Bangkok, a remarkable transformation is taking place on a small rooftop above a five-story apartment building, where creative architecture meets urban necessity. Designed by WARchitect, this wooden residence not only epitomizes warmth but also addresses the challenges of city living, redefining what it means to reside above the bustling streets.
From Utility to Sanctuary
Once a neglected space dominated by water tanks, the rooftop now houses a personal haven that soars over the city skyline. The owner’s vision was bold: to craft a peaceful escape that emerged subtly above urban chaos. The majority of the house is hidden from view, allowing the structure to blend harmoniously with the existing apartment below. WARchitect ingeniously set the house back from the roof's edge, maintaining the apartment’s original aesthetic while introducing an element of modern design.
Architectural Marvels: Materials and Techniques
The design showcases a seamless flow of wood from interior to exterior, with Balau wood used throughout. Embracing the wood's natural imperfections—such as saw marks, knots, and color variations—WARchitect has crafted a space that celebrates authenticity. The illusion of thinness is a striking effect; walls appear to float, utilizing drop ceilings and hidden features to provide a sense of openness and calm. This focus on simplicity and clarity defines the entire structure, making it a peaceful retreat.
Blurring Boundaries Between Indoors and Outdoors
Central to this rooftop dwelling is a small internal courtyard, which draws the outdoors inside and provides light and greenery. This courtyard is visible from almost every part of the home, enhancing the connection to the vibrant environment while still maintaining an atmosphere of privacy. With strategically placed large openings, the living room captures panoramic views, free from the clutter often associated with urban living.
Function Meets Aesthetic
One of the key qualities of this residence is its thoughtful layout. Bedrooms are tucked away discreetly, maximizing the feeling of space while maintaining intimacy. The design eschews unnecessary extravagance, crafting a practical yet beautifully simple home. Each area flows into the next, creating a unified living experience. The bathrooms, adorned with white accents, serve as refreshing contrasts to the warm tones of the wood, ensuring that each space retains its unique character while still fitting seamlessly into the whole.
